Paramount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I think I may have worn out my old VHS copy of this film. <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Raiders of the Lost Ark<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is truly one of the greatest adventure films ever made. Harrison Ford is unbeatable as the iconic Indiana Jones, an archaeologist and full-time adventurer whose charisma carries the film from beginning to end.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Spielberg directed the film for his friend George Lucas, who created the character and developed his backstory. I remember reading that Spielberg initially viewed the project as something of a \u201cB-movie,\u201d although it certainly did not turn out that way. Instead, <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Raiders of the Lost Ark<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> became the highest-grossing film of 1981 and one of the most influential adventure films in cinematic history.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><i>E.T. the Extra-Terrestrial<\/i><\/b><b> (1982)<\/b><\/h3>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29657\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29657\" style=\"width: 657px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" data-attachment-id=\"29657\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/home\/spielbergs-best-films\/screenshot-10\/\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/IMG_2373.jpg?fit=1179%2C628&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"1179,628\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;,&quot;alt&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;E.T. the Extra-Terrestrial (1982).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The Color Purple<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is one film I almost always forget was directed by Spielberg because it feels so different from much of his other work. The film carries a predominantly somber tone, yet its overall message is ultimately one of hope and resilience.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Whoopi Goldberg delivers a remarkable performance, leaving much of her comedic persona behind. I also remember reading about Spielberg&#8217;s initial hesitation to direct the film. Producer Quincy Jones originally approached him, but Spielberg felt that a person of color should direct the story. Jones reportedly responded, \u201cYou didn\u2019t have to be an alien to direct <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">E.T.<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201d Well played, Jones.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><i>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ade<\/i><\/b><b> (1989)<\/b><\/h3>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29649\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29649\" style=\"width: 750px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" data-attachment-id=\"29649\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/home\/spielbergs-best-films\/screenshot-2\/\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/IMG_2375.jpg?fit=1179%2C550&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"1179,550\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;,&quot;alt&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ade (1989). Universal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I do not usually cry while watching films, but <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Schindler\u2019s List<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is a rare exception. When I was younger, before I had developed much of an appreciation for cinematography, I wondered why a film made in the 1990s would be shot in black and white. Now, I see it as one of Spielberg&#8217;s most effective creative choices.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The liquidation of the Krak\u00f3w ghetto is a prime example. The image of the little girl in the red coat provides a powerful visual symbol and represents a turning point for Oskar Schindler, played brilliantly by Liam Neeson. Schindler initially arrives in Poland hoping to profit from the war, but he gradually develops sympathy for the Jewish people and becomes determined to save as many lives as possible.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Schindler\u2019s List<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is a remarkable film, and it is clear that the subject matter was deeply challenging for Spielberg. Nevertheless, the result is an extraordinary piece of filmmaking that remains one of his most important works.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><i>Saving Private Ryan<\/i><\/b><b> (1998)<\/b><\/h3>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29652\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29652\" style=\"width: 657px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" data-attachment-id=\"29652\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/home\/spielbergs-best-films\/screenshot-5\/\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/IMG_2378.jpg?fit=1179%2C628&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"1179,628\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;,&quot;alt&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;Saving Private Ryan (1998). DreamWorks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Minority Report<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is my favorite Spielberg film. I love virtually everything about it. From its futuristic visuals to its performances and atmosphere, the film consistently knocks me back in my seat.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I usually think of films set in the future as straightforward science fiction, but <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Minority Report<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> feels much closer to film noir. Tom Cruise plays John Anderton, a police officer who leads PreCrime, a specialized unit capable of arresting people before they commit murder. However, Anderton goes on the run after discovering that he is a future murderer. His experience causes him to question the stability, morality, and validity of the entire PreCrime system.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I have seen this film numerous times, and it still gives me a thrill every time I watch it. Spielberg&#8217;s ability to combine futuristic technology, noir conventions, action, and philosophical questions makes <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Minority Report<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> endlessly rewatchable.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><i>Munich<\/i><\/b><b> (2005)<\/b><\/h3>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29654\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29654\" style=\"width: 842px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" data-attachment-id=\"29654\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/home\/spielbergs-best-films\/screenshot-7\/\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/IMG_2380.jpg?fit=1179%2C490&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"1179,490\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;,&quot;alt&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;Munich (2005). Universal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I think <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Munich<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> does not get talked about nearly enough. The film dramatizes the aftermath of one of the most heinous acts of terrorism in Olympic history: the 1972 Munich massacre, in which members of the Israeli Olympic team were taken hostage by the Palestinian militant group Black September.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Eric Bana plays Avner Kaufman, an Israeli agent tasked with assassinating individuals believed to have been responsible for orchestrating the attack. As the mission progresses, however, the boundaries between justice, vengeance, and morality begin to blur.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This is a beautifully made film, featuring exceptional camerawork, cinematography, and another chilling score from John Williams. More importantly, <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Munich<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> raises a difficult question: Does vengeance actually heal the wounds it is intended to address, or does it simply pass guilt and suffering on to someone else?<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b><i>The Fabelmans<\/i><\/b><b> (2022)<\/b><\/h3>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29655\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29655\" style=\"width: 653px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" data-attachment-id=\"29655\" data-permalink=\"https:\/\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/home\/spielbergs-best-films\/screenshot-8\/\" data-orig-file=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/ryansmoviecorner.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/IMG_2381.jpg?fit=1179%2C632&amp;ssl=1\" data-orig-size=\"1179,632\" data-comments-opened=\"1\" data-image-meta=\"{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;Screenshot&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;,&quot;alt&quot;:&quot;&quot;}\" data-image-title=\"\" data-image-description=\"\" data-image-caption=\"&lt;p&gt;The Fabelmans (2022). Universal Pictures.<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The Fabelmans<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is a semi-autobiographical film inspired by Spielberg&#8217;s own childhood and his journey toward becoming a filmmaker. For that reason alone, it feels like mandatory viewing for Spielberg fans. It can also be a wonderful experience for film lovers in general, as the story centers on a young man&#8217;s growing love for cinema and his discovery of what filmmaking means to him.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It is a deeply touching film with excellent performances throughout. Judd Hirsch, despite having a relatively brief appearance, is particularly memorable. The final scene featuring David Lynch portraying the legendary filmmaker John Ford is a delight!<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I was surprised by the casting, since I had primarily known Lynch as the creator and star of <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Twin Peaks<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. His appearance provides a satisfying conclusion to the film and serves as a fitting final touch to Spielberg&#8217;s deeply personal story.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">I could tell that Spielberg had a great deal of fun making <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The Fabelmans<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, as I imagine he has with many of his films throughout his career. In many ways, the film feels like a love letter to filmmaking itself\u2014and perhaps to the very medium that inspired Spielberg to become one of its greatest practitioners.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Happy watching!<\/span><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>I cannot believe it has taken me this long to compose a list of the best films directed by Steven Spielberg.
